What is driving Lumentum Holdings Inc (LITE)’s stock price up today?

Lumentum Holdings Inc. is experiencing a notable upward trend following the release of its latest fiscal quarterly results, which exceeded consensus expectations across key financial metrics. The company reported a significant recovery in its cloud and networking segment, driven by an accelerating replacement cycle for high-speed optical transceivers. As major data center operators transition toward 800G and 1.6T architectures to support large language model training, Lumentum has successfully positioned itself as a critical infrastructure provider, leading to improved margins and a positive revision of its forward earnings guidance.

The broader industry environment for photonics is showing signs of a cyclical bottoming out, with inventory levels normalizing among telecommunications customers. This shift has alleviated long-standing concerns regarding the pace of infrastructure spending and terrestrial network upgrades. Furthermore, the company’s recent technological advancements in silicon photonics and high-power laser chips have strengthened its competitive moat against regional rivals. Analysts have responded to these developments by raising price targets, citing Lumentum’s increased market share in the hyperscale data center market as a primary driver for long-term valuation expansion.

Investor sentiment is also being bolstered by updates regarding the company’s consumer electronics business. Positive indicators from the global smartphone supply chain suggest a higher-than-expected adoption rate for advanced 3D sensing and LiDAR components in upcoming flagship models. This diversification helps mitigate the volatility inherent in the networking sector, providing a more stable revenue floor. Institutional accumulation has intensified as the company demonstrates its ability to leverage its specialized optical expertise into the rapidly growing field of optical interconnects for artificial intelligence.

From a macroeconomic perspective, the stabilization of interest rates and a cooling inflation outlook have created a favorable backdrop for mid-cap technology stocks with strong growth profiles. While operational risks such as supply chain bottlenecks and geopolitical tensions in the semiconductor equipment space remain, the market is currently prioritizing Lumentum’s aggressive expansion into high-growth AI applications. The combination of structural demand for bandwidth and the company’s disciplined cost management continues to attract capital, resulting in the current period of heightened trading activity and price appreciation.

Company Specific Risks:

  • Prolonged Telecommunications Inventory Correction: Persistent inventory destocking among traditional service providers continues to depress demand for high-margin optical transport products, offsetting the growth seen in the data center segment.
  • Gross Margin Contraction: A significant year-over-year decline in non-GAAP gross margins reflects a shift in product mix toward lower-margin initial AI deployments and the under-absorption of fixed costs within legacy manufacturing facilities.
  • High Customer Concentration: A substantial portion of total revenue remains tied to a limited number of networking and cloud giants, making the company highly vulnerable to single-client capital expenditure pivots or changes in internal sourcing strategies.
  • Elevated Debt Servicing Requirements: The presence of significant convertible senior notes on the balance sheet creates a heavy interest expense burden, which continues to pressure GAAP net income and limits the capital available for aggressive M&A or R&D in the 1.6T transceiver cycle.
